On 12/11/2013 5:01 p.m., Steve Shipway wrote:
In our production Sympa environment running version v6.1.14 (Élias) we
have found a message which makes a bulk.pl hang. Further, it seems to
stop all lists on our listserv from processing (until we manually kill
off affected bulk.pl process(es) and restart Sympa services).

The regexp error you mention seems to occur in the TT2 parsing code.

Does this list have MailMerge enabled on it? Possibly this is causing the
problem, as the message has something in it that looks like TT2 code but
isn’t. If so, disable mailmerge on the list (you should have it disabled
anyway for this sort of data)

Brilliant - that's what the issue was alright. I had enabled merge_feature by default (i.e. "merge_feature on" in sympa.conf).

Thank you very much for this. We've had a few unexplained / strange hangs of bulk.pl processes - hopefully this addresses it. (I had wondered why attempts were being made to regexp parse the message.) I have run sympa.pl --reload_list_config to rebuild our binary config files, and intend to 'whitelist' any lists that need this feature.

It would seem that you need to be careful with this setting. As noted, this caused our entire listserv to become unavailable. (By sending a 'bad' message, such as the one sent to our list, it looks like a DoS can be caused on demand if merge_feature is known to be enabled on a particular list and you have rights to post.)

Because this bad message was already queued, I had to manually set merge_bulkmailer to 0 in bulkmailer_table (independent of changing the list configuration) to get the message to clear.
